The Salvation Army Headquarters. Original publishers black cloth with red titles; wear to the boards; soiling; front hinge starting; drink ring. Prior owner stamps on inside front cover and ffep. Author signatures at end of introduction either in black liquid ink or printed, cannot tell which. Original scarce in any condition. . Good. Hardcover. 1st Edition. 1891.
